#your-shopping-cart form a.continue-shopping,#your-shopping-cart form.cart,#your-shopping-cart form.cart .cart__row .top p.taxes,#your-shopping-cart form.cart input[type=submit]{font-family:GT Walsheim Light,sans-serif}#insta-feed>div{padding:0 25px}.cart-table,.cart-table tbody,.cart__row,.cart__row .image{position:relative}.cart_promo_grid p,.cart_shopnow p,.cnt_cart .contact_grid_info p,.summary{font-family:GT Walsheim Light}#your-shopping-cart.cart_empty .new-index-collection,#your-shopping-cart.cart_not_empty .newcart-image-text,#your-shopping-cart.cart_not_empty .video_text{display:block}#birth-day-hidden,#birth-month-hidden,#birth-year-hidden,#your-shopping-cart form.cart .cart__row #gift-checkbox,#your-shopping-cart h1,#your-shopping-cart.cart_empty .newcart-image-text,#your-shopping-cart.cart_empty .video_text,#your-shopping-cart.cart_not_empty .new-index-collection,.cart-accordian-section,.mobile_packag_grid,.mobile_qty_selector,.sticky_cart_form{display:none}.cart-table tr:after{content:"";border-bottom:1px solid #7c7c7c;height:1px;width:100%;left:0;position:absolute;bottom:0}.cart_notes_grid ::placeholder{color:#7c7c7c;font-size:14px;font-family:GT Walsheim Light;line-height:20px}.cart_notes{margin-top:0!important}table.full{margin-bottom:0}#your-shopping-cart h1{text-transform:uppercase;font-weight:300;font-size:1.3rem;letter-spacing:.1rem}#your-shopping-cart form.cart .cart__row{vertical-align:top}#your-shopping-cart form.cart table thead{border-top:0}.cart__row:first-child{padding-top:0;margin-top:0}form.cart table thead tr th{text-transform:capitalize;letter-spacing:.08em;color:#0d2035;padding:15px 0}.table__section .product_desc_cart{padding-left:45px;padding-top:30px}form.cart table tbody tr td.image{padding:0 0 30px;width:219px}form.cart table.cart-table td.quantity{width:100px;display:flex;margin:0 auto;padding:21px 0 0}form.cart table.cart-table td.quantity input{width:50%;border:none;font-size:17px;padding:0;font-family:GT Walsheim}form input[type=number]{border-radius:0;text-align:center;border-color:#c9d6e7;font-family:GT Walsheim Light}form.cart table.cart-table td.quantity input[type=submit]{clear:both;margin:2px auto;background:0 0;border-radius:0;border:0;padding:0;font-family:GT Walsheim Light;text-transform:uppercase;letter-spacing:.1rem;text-align:center;color:#0d2035;float:none;font-size:.9rem;opacity:0;visibility:hidden;transition:.4s;outline:0}.money{letter-spacing:.03em}#your-shopping-cart form.cart table tbody tr td a.h3,#your-shopping-cart form.cart table tbody tr td a.h4,#your-shopping-cart form.cart table tbody tr td span.h3,#your-shopping-cart form.cart table tbody tr td span.h4{font-size:17px;line-height:21px;text-transform:capitalize;color:#0d2035;font-family:GT Walsheim;font-weight:100;letter-spacing:0}.cart__row{margin-top:30px;padding-top:30px;border-top:0}#your-shopping-cart form a.continue-shopping{text-transform:uppercase;letter-spacing:.08em;border-radius:0;font-weight:300;transition:.4s;float:left}#your-shopping-cart form textarea.input-full{outline:0;transition:.4s;border-color:#7c7c7c;border-radius:0}#your-shopping-cart form.cart input[type=submit]{display:none;border:1px solid #0d2035;text-transform:uppercase;letter-spacing:.08em;border-radius:0;font-weight:300;padding:10px 40px 10px 30px;transition:.4s;background-repeat:no-repeat;background-position:220px 12px;background-color:#0d2035;color:#fff;background-image:url(/cdn/shop/t/50/assets/arrow-right-white.svg?v=1042887\2026)}#your-shopping-cart form a.continue-shopping,#your-shopping-cart form a.update-cart,#your-shopping-cart form input[type=submit].continue-shopping,#your-shopping-cart form input[type=submit].update-cart{background-color:transparent;border:1px solid #0d2035;color:#0d2035;margin:20px 0;padding:10px 20px}#your-shopping-cart form.cart .cart__row .top{float:left;width:100%;border-top:1px solid #c9d6e7;padding-top:10px}#your-shopping-cart a#customer-care-number{display:block;margin-top:10px;color:#a6a8aa}#your-shopping-cart form.cart .cart__row .top p span.cart__subtotal{font-weight:300;font-size:16px}#your-shopping-cart form.cart .cart__row .top p span.cart__subtotal,#your-shopping-cart form.cart .cart__row .top p span.cart__subtotal-title{font-family:GT Walsheim Light,sans-serif;letter-spacing:1px}.cart__grid{margin:0 50px 57px}.template-cart .main-content{margin-top:0}.cart__grid .cart_title{text-transform:uppercase;letter-spacing:1.94px;line-height:42px;margin-bottom:44px}.cart_shopnow{text-align:center}.cart_shopnow p{font-size:17px;line-height:21px;margin-bottom:60px;margin-top:55px}.eng-btn.cart-shopnow{background:#0d2035;color:#fff}.eng-btn.cart-shopnow:hover{background:0 0;color:#0d2035}.cart_promo_bar{background:#ede9e4;margin-left:-50px;margin-right:-50px;margin-bottom:49px}.cart_cummary_grid,.select_packag label.active:after{background:#0d2035}.select_packag label{display:flex;align-items:baseline}.cart_promo_grid p{margin:12px 10px;font-size:17px;letter-spacing:0;line-height:21px;flex:1 1 auto;text-align:center}.cart_promo_grid,.qtybox{display:flex;align-items:center;justify-content:center}.cnt_cart,.product_cart_grid{display:flex;justify-content:space-between}.cart-table th,.cart__row td{border:none}.cart__row td[data-label=Price]{text-align:center;padding-top:30px}.cart__row td[data-label=Price] span{letter-spacing:1px}.cart_summary{margin-left:62px}.cart__row .image .cart__image{height:246px;width:219px;background:#f4f4f4;position:relative;top:30px;margin-bottom:30px}.cart__image img{position:absolute;object-fit:cover;height:100%;width:100%}.reduce_note_grid p:after,.select_packag label,.select_packag label:after{position:relative;cursor:pointer}.cart_cummary_grid{color:#fff;border-radius:23px;padding:38px}.cnt_cart .contact_grid_info a{align-items:start;margin-bottom:0!important}.cnt_cart .contact_grid_info:last-child a{align-items:end;margin-bottom:0!important;-webkit-justify-content:flex-end;align-items:flex-end;-webkit-align-items:flex-end}.summary{color:#fff;line-height:28px;letter-spacing:2px;margin-bottom:30px}.cart__subtotal,.reduce_note,.sub_total,.taxes{color:#fff;display:flex;font-family:GT Walsheim Light;font-size:17px;align-items:center;justify-content:space-between;line-height:21px}.taxes{margin-bottom:0;border-bottom:1px solid;padding-bottom:15px}.btn_checkout,.btn_checkout:hover{border:1px solid #fff}.reduce_note{font-size:14px;line-height:16px}.cart__remove,.packag_title{font-family:GT Walsheim;line-height:17px}.reduce_note_grid{justify-content:space-between;align-items:center;color:#fff;margin-top:14px;cursor:pointer;display:none}.reduce_note_grid p:after{content:"";border:1px solid #fff;display:inline-block;vertical-align:middle;margin-left:11px;height:24px;width:24px}.reduce_note_grid input:checked+p:after{content:"\2713";text-align:center;padding-top:3px}.reduce_note_grid input{margin-right:0;height:24px;width:24px;margin-left:27px;display:none}.btn_checkout{max-width:100%;background:#fff;width:100%;margin-top:20px;margin-bottom:33px}.product_desc_cart .h4{float:left;display:block;width:100%;align-items:start!important}.cart_notes_grid{display:flex;width:100%}.cart_notes textarea:first-child{margin-right:33px}.cnt_cart .contact_grid_info:nth-child(2){text-align:right}.cnt_cart .cnt_title{font-size:17px;margin-top:20px;font-weight:400;letter-spacing:0}.cnt_cart .contact_grid_info p{font-size:14px;margin-bottom:0;line-height:30px;color:#fff;letter-spacing:.64px}.cnt_cart .contact_grid_info img{width:55px;height:50px}.product_desc_cart small{color:#7c7c7c;font-size:12px;display:block;line-height:24px;letter-spacing:0}.cart__remove{color:#0d2035;width:fit-content;border-bottom:1px solid}.packag_title{color:#0d2035;font-weight:100;font-size:14px}.select_packag{margin-top:8px;line-height:16px;margin-bottom:10px;display:flex}.qtydiv,.qtydiv .btnqty,.qtydiv .quantity-input{display:inline-block}.select_packag input{padding:0;height:initial;width:initial;margin-bottom:0;display:none;cursor:pointer}.select_packag label:after{content:"";background-color:transparent;border:1px solid #0d2035;padding:5px;display:inline-block;vertical-align:middle;margin-left:11px;transform:rotate(45.00004deg)}.select_packag label:first-child{margin-right:20px!important}.qtydiv label{display:block;margin-bottom:12px;letter-spacing:2.8px;color:#747a7b}.qtydiv .btnqty{cursor:pointer;-webkit-user-select:none;user-select:none;font-size:30px;padding:5px;color:#0d2035}.qtydiv .btnqty.qtyminus{margin-right:0;padding:0}.qtydiv .btnqty.qtyplus{margin-left:0;padding:0}.qtydiv .quantity-input{border:none;padding:8px;text-align:center;width:50px;outline:0}.cart_get_toch{position:absolute;right:0;bottom:10px}.cart_product_detail{width:70%}@media screen and (min-width: 1400px){.cart_summary{width:30%}}@media screen and (max-width: 1300px){.cart_summary{margin-left:55px}.cart_product_detail{width:80%}.cart_summary{margin-left:45px}}@media screen and (max-width: 1235px){.cart_promo_grid p{font-size:15px}}@media screen and (max-width: 1199px){.cart__grid{margin:0 10px 57px}.cart_promo_bar{margin-left:0;margin-right:0}form.cart table tbody tr td.image{width:150px}.cart__row .image .cart__image{height:150px;width:150px}.table__section .product_desc_cart{padding-left:30px}.cart_summary{margin-left:30px}.cart_cummary_grid{padding:30px}.cart_promo_grid p{margin:12px 15px;font-size:15px;line-height:20px}}@media screen and (max-width: 1042px){.cart_promo_grid p{font-size:13px}}@media screen and (max-width: 916px){.cart_promo_bar{display:none}.cart_get_toch{font-size:12px}}@media screen and (max-width: 990px){form.cart table tbody tr td.image{width:100px}.cart__row .image .cart__image{height:100px;width:100px}form.cart table.cart-table td.quantity{width:60px}.select_packag label:first-child{margin-right:5px!important}.select_packag label:after{margin-left:5px;padding:4px}.cart_cummary_grid{padding:25px}.cart_summary{margin-left:15px}.summary{line-height:24px;margin-bottom:20px}.cnt_cart .contact_grid_info img{width:50px;height:45px}.cnt_cart .cnt_title{font-size:16px;margin-top:15px}.reduce_note_grid p:after{height:20px;width:25px}.table__section .product_desc_cart{padding-left:15px}}@media screen and (max-width: 868px){.contact_us_enquiry a{font-size:18px;line-height:35px}.video_text_inner{z-index:0}.cart-accordian-section{display:block}#your-shopping-cart h1{margin-bottom:0}form.cart table tbody tr td.image{padding-bottom:30px;width:100px}#your-shopping-cart.cart_not_empty .newcart-image-text,#your-shopping-cart.cart_not_empty .video_text,.cart-table tr:after,.cart__header-labels,.cart_get_toch,.cart_notes,.cart_promo_bar,.cart_summary,.packag_grid,.product_desc_cart small.sku,form.cart table.cart-table td.quantity{display:none}.cart_product_detail{width:100%}.sticky_cart_form{display:block;position:fixed;bottom:0;background:#ece3d8;width:100%;left:0;padding:20px 15px;z-index:9999999}.sticky_cart_form .btn_checkout{margin:0;background:#f34d0a;border:1px solid #f34d0a;color:#fff;font-family:GT Walsheim;font-size:18px;height:60px}.sticky_cart_form .ship_text{font-size:14px;line-height:16px;font-family:GT Walsheim Light;margin-bottom:0}.cart__subtotal,.sticky_cart_form .sub_total{font-size:19px;line-height:34px;color:#0d2035;font-family:GT Walsheim}.cart__subtotal,.mobile_packag_grid select{font-family:GT Walsheim Light}.cart__grid{margin:0;padding:0 10px}#your-shopping-cart form.cart .cart__row{border-color:#7c7c7c}.mobile_packag_grid{display:block;margin:5px 0}.mobile_qty_selector{display:flex;align-items:center}.cart_product_detail select{background-image:url(/cdn/shop/files/Stroke_1.png?v=1661500712);border:none}.mobile_packag_grid select{background-color:#efefef;width:80%}.cart__remove{position:absolute;right:20px;bottom:10px}.cart__row td[data-label=Price]{text-align:right;padding-bottom:0;padding-top:20px}.cart__row .image .cart__image{background:#fff;top:20px;margin-bottom:10px;height:150px;width:150px}.table__section .product_desc_cart{padding-left:15px;padding-bottom:0;padding-top:20px}}@media screen and (max-width: 550px){.cart__row .image .cart__image{height:90px;width:90px}form.cart table tbody tr td.image{width:90px}#your-shopping-cart form.cart table tbody tr td a.h4,#your-shopping-cart form.cart table tbody tr td a.h3,#your-shopping-cart form.cart table tbody tr td span.h3,#your-shopping-cart form.cart table tbody tr td span.h4{font-size:14px;line-height:17px}.product_desc_cart small{line-height:15px}.mobile_packag_grid select{padding:5px;font-size:12px;background-size:10px}.table--responsive td:before{display:none}.table--responsive td{display:table-cell;text-align:left;float:unset}}@media screen and (max-width: 450px){.mobile_packag_grid select{width:100%;font-size:11px}.mobile_packag_grid select,.mobile_qty_selector select{background-size:10px}.table__section .product_desc_cart{padding-left:10px}}.checkout-terms a{color:#fff}.form-group.checkout-terms{display:flex;align-items:center;margin-top:15px;justify-content:space-between}.form-group.checkout-terms input{padding:0;height:initial;width:initial;margin-bottom:0;display:none;cursor:pointer}.form-group.checkout-terms label{position:relative;cursor:pointer}.form-group.checkout-terms label:before{content:"";-webkit-appearance:none;background-color:transparent;border:1px solid #fff;padding:10px;display:inline-block;position:relative;vertical-align:middle;cursor:pointer;margin-right:5px}.form-group.checkout-terms input:checked+label:after{content:"";display:block;position:absolute;top:5px;left:8px;width:6px;height:12px;border:solid #fff;border-width:0 1px 1px 0;transform:rotate(45deg)}.form-group.checkout-terms a{display:block}.form-group.checkout-terms b{font-weight:100;border-bottom:1px solid}.check-terms-box:before{border-color:#11ef11!important}.order-ship-text-grid{display:flex;align-items:flex-start;background-color:#f4f4f4;border-radius:12px;padding:11px;gap:17px;font-size:12px;line-height:15px;letter-spacing:0;justify-content:space-between;width:240px;font-weight:600}.order-ship-text-grid img{width:53px}.ship_text{max-width:151px;color:#0d2032;font-family:GT Walsheim;font-weight:100}.ship_oredr-wrap{position:absolute;right:0;bottom:24px;text-align:right}.ship_text p{font-size:10px;line-height:12px;font-family:GT Walsheim Light;color:#7c7c7c;max-width:118px;text-align:right;margin:3px 0 0 auto}.ship_text .mobile{display:none}@media screen and (max-width: 1024px){.order-ship-text-grid{width:auto;gap:5px}}@media screen and (max-width: 868px){.order-ship-text-grid img,.ship_text .desktop{display:none}.ship_text .mobile{display:block}.ship_text{max-width:100%}.cart__remove{bottom:50px}.ship_oredr-wrap{bottom:-5px}.table__section+.table__section:after{content:"";display:block;position:absolute;top:0;left:15px;right:15px;border-bottom:1px solid var(--color-Border)}}@media screen and (max-width: 450px){.order-ship-text-grid{font-size:11px}}
/*# sourceMappingURL=/cdn/shop/t/83/assets/cart.css.map */
